You are viewing a preview of this job. Log in or register to view more details about this job.

Python Developer Intern

Hello future interns! 

We are Infrrd - the Enterprise AI company that uses AI and Machine Learning technologies to help our customers automate human tasks. We are looking for Python Developer intern who will help implement solutions for the specific needs of our various clients and/or contribute to the development of our products. This internship will start immediately.

Like any job, it has its do's and don'ts. Let's talk about don'ts first. We are not looking for someone who: 
1. Cannot write concise, performance efficient code. 
2. Does not want to stay hands-on with code for a long time to come. 
3. Cannot solve complex problems fast! We compete with some of the best companies on the planet and we need teammates who can give tough competition to these companies – in terms of both speed and accuracy. 
 
With the don'ts out of the way, let’s talk about the good stuff. 
About Infrrd
1. We are a team of about 350 people, so while we are young - we are not a start-up. 
2. There are three levels of people in our team - those who do the work, those who can fix things when they are not working, and the ones that can own outcomes. This job belongs in the Second category. You will be responsible for combining analysis and curiosity to understand how things work and what can be done to make them work better. 
3. Our team is spread in 3 parts of the globe - the US, Europe, and India. You will need to be comfortable working with remote colleagues. 
4. We have 4 simple values that we run our company with – 
  • The captain must go down with the ship, 
  • Do the right thing, 
  • Don’t sweat the small stuff and 
  • Have Fun. You can read more about this here- 
 
If you have read this far, then you may want to know what background we would like our Python Developer intern to have. We have made a list, here it is: 
What we look for -  
  • Strong Python skills (Python 3.4+) with understanding the performance issues, code readability and maintainability 
  • Experience in OOP/functional coding in Python 
  • Has a knack for writing scripts quickly to automate any repetitive/manual task during development or deployment 
  • Experience in Python frameworks like Flask/Django 
  • Strong ownership of the task at hand 
  • Experience/knowledge of databases 
What you will be working on - 
  • Write well designed, testable and efficient code with comprehensive code coverage and documentation 
  • Design reliable distributed systems that handle high volume of data with low latency 
  • Ensure the deliverables are of the highest quality in terms of functional and technical aspects 
  • Benchmarking and evaluation of the machine learning modules 
  • Gather data from various data sources at Infrrd and transform the data to the required formats into proprietary data and tagging tools 
  • Data analysis, pattern & trend identification and generating actionable items, visualization of data insights 
  • Work cross-functionally with data entry, machine learning engineers to build world-class products and design hypothesis-driven experiments; make clear, coherent and holistic recommendations based on test results 
 
We aspire to be a big brand and we have put 9 years of grueling work to get to where we have reached. We are looking for someone to join us on our journey to create a company that future generations can be proud of. As a Python Developer we would like you to pay attention to detail for all our work.  

Look forward to hearing from you!